Hi, I know this is a few steps on from WW1, but I'm trying to trace any descendants of Harold Washington, who was in the Duke Of Wellington's in Ireland in 1920. He was killed that September, aged 15, during an IRA ambush in Dublin along with two other young British soldiers: Thomas Humphries (19), of 140 Coates St, West Bowling, Bradford and Marshall Whitehead (20) of Hope Street, Halifax. Washington's address was 189 Regent Road, Salford. His father, George, was a shoemaker and his mother's name was Harriet (nee Whatmough). They also lost two other sons during WW1. One of the IRA attackers, Kevin Barry, was aged 18, arrested and hanged for his part in the ambush. That aspect took on great significance at the time and since, but it was a lost part of the story that the three British casualties were so young. The point of this research is to try and join the two parts of the story together again.
